Biostar Hi-Fi K1-I Ver. 6.x



Processor Biostar Hi-Fi K1-I Ver. 6.x

Socket:
LGA1150
Supported processors:
Intel Core i7/Core i5/Core i3/Pentium
Support multi-core processors:
yes

Chipset Biostar Hi-Fi K1-I Ver. 6.x

Chipset:
Intel H81
EFI:
yes
SLI/CrossFire:?Scalable Link Interface
no

Memory Biostar Hi-Fi K1-I Ver. 6.x

Memory:
DDR3 DIMMs, 1066 - 1600 MHz
Number of memory slots:
2
Supports dual channel mode:
yes
The maximum amount of memory:
16 GB

Disk controllers Biostar Hi-Fi K1-I Ver. 6.x

IDE:?Integrated Drive Electronics
no
SATA:?Serial Advanced Technology Attachment
the number of connectors SATA 3Gb/s: 2, number of connectors SATA 6Gb/s: 2

Expansion slots Biostar Hi-Fi K1-I Ver. 6.x

Expansion slots:
1xPCI-E x16, 1xPCI-E x1
PCI Express 2.0 support:
yes

Audio/video Biostar Hi-Fi K1-I Ver. 6.x

Sound:
stereo, HDA, based on C-Media CM108AH

Network Biostar Hi-Fi K1-I Ver. 6.x

Ethernet:
1000 Mbit/s, based on the Realtek RTL8111G

Connection Biostar Hi-Fi K1-I Ver. 6.x

The presence of interfaces:
8 USB, 2 USB 3.0, 1xCOM, D-Sub, HDMI, Ethernet, PS/2 (keyboard), PS/2 (mouse)
The connectors on the rear panel:
4 USB, D-Sub, HDMI, Ethernet, PS/2 (keyboard), PS/2 (mouse)
Main power connector:
24-pin
Power connector processor:
4-pin
The type of cooling system:
passive

Additional options Biostar Hi-Fi K1-I Ver. 6.x

Form factor:
microATX
Trim:
2 SATA cable, plug the rear ports of hull
